Suspension Work in Norfolk / VB

Does anyone know of anyone or a shop that does reputable suspension work? Or does anyone have a garage and want to help me put mine on? I'll pay w/in reason, just tell me how much.

I have the H&R Touring Cup Kit (springs & shocks).

I tried to do it w/ a friend in PA last month, but got stuck nearly stripping the torques screw under the driver's side front control arm. Has anyone else experienced problems w/ this? I didn't want to keep going b/c I had to drive back to VA the same day, so it never got done. We ended up breaking three torque bits...Yes, 3. You would think we were doing something wrong, but the nut came about 75% of the way off...looked like it had sealant on it. Then I just finally called it quits and screwed it back on. Sucks.
